Bakers Delight Censorship Attempt Denied

MELBOURNE, Australia (Blue MauMau) - In an attempt to gain control of the Bakersdelightlies.com website, Bakers Delight laid a complaint on January 2, 2008 with the World Intellectual Property Organisation (WIPO), seeking an order that the domain name be transferred to Bakers Delight control.

The WIPO has investigated the Bakers Delight complaint and returned its decision in favour of the respondent.

In summary the WIPO found that “the website does not have any commercial content, and is apparently dedicated to genuine criticism, with relevant non‑commercial links. There is nothing before the Panel to establish that the Respondent is making any commercial gain, from visitors or advertising or otherwise, and is apparently not attempting to divert users looking for the Complainant’s site. “

Accordingly, the Panel found that “the Respondent has on the face of it a legitimate interest in respect of the disputed domain name.”

A full copy of the Bakers Delight complaint and the subsequent WIPO decision is able to be downloaded from www.bakersdelightlies.com

Note: Bakers Delight is the world’s largest bakery franchise, operating in Australia and New Zealand as Bakers Delight and trading under the name of COBS Bread in Canada and the United States.
